John Lewis head of direct marketing departs

LONDON - Miranda Goodenough, head of direct marketing at John Lewis, has left her job to pursue a career elsewhere, according to the retailer.

The announcement follows Gill Barr's departure from the company as part of a marketing restructure. The direct marketing team will now merge into the brand communications team, which sits alongside creative services, both part of the marketing department. All the marketing department teams will report to Jill Little, the group's merchandise director, who sits on the board.

A spokeswoman for John Lewis said: ‘The role of head of direct marketing is under review. Our relationships with our agencies, including Kitcatt Nohr, are unaffected.'

Kitcatt Nohr Alexander Shaw currently hold the group's direct marketing account.
